Unknown components are surrounded by wrapper components, which give a default structure for displaying the child components. This pattern is excellent for designing user interface (UI) elements like modals, template pages, and information tiles that are used repeatedly throughout a design.

Wrapper components are a way to decouple the logic of your application from its presentation. They allow you to reuse and share the logic of your application without sharing its user interface.

The difference between a React component and a React wrapper component is that the former includes a render function while the latter wraps an existing DOM element with new functionality and data.

Wrapping components is a technique that allows developers to add an extra layer of abstraction on top of the existing system and make it more flexible.

